What is Mincom.Windows.Shell.Api.dll?
A DLL (Dynamic Link Library) file is a type of file that contains code and data that can be used by multiple programs at the same time. It helps to reduce the duplication of code in different programs and makes it easier for software developers to update and maintain their programs. Common Issues and Errors Related to Mincom.Windows.Shell.Api.dll
Although essential for system performance, dynamic Link Library (DLL) files can occasionally cause specific errors. The following enumerates some of the most common DLL errors users encounter while operating their systems:
- Cannot register Mincom.Windows.Shell.Api.dll: This denotes a failure in the system's attempt to register the DLL file, which might occur if the DLL file is damaged, if the system lacks the necessary permissions, or if there's a conflict with another registered DLL.
- Mincom.Windows.Shell.Api.dll Access Violation: This message indicates that a program has tried to access memory that it shouldn't. It could be caused by software bugs, outdated drivers, or conflicts between software.
- This application failed to start because Mincom.Windows.Shell.Api.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This error is thrown when a necessary DLL file is not found by the application. It might have been accidentally deleted or misplaced. Reinstallation of the application can possibly resolve this issue by replacing the missing DLL file.
- Mincom.Windows.Shell.Api.dll not found: The required DLL file is absent from the expected directory. This can result from software uninstalls, updates, or system changes that mistakenly remove or relocate DLL files.
- Mincom.Windows.Shell.Api.dll could not be loaded: This error signifies that the system encountered an issue while trying to load the DLL file. Possible reasons include the DLL being missing, the presence of an outdated version, or conflicts with other DLL files in the system.

Run the Windows Check Disk Utility
In this guide, we will explain how to use the Check Disk Utility to fix Mincom.Windows.Shell.Api.dll errors.
-
Press the Windows key.
-
Type
Command Promptin the search bar and press Enter. -
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.
-
In the Command Prompt window, type
chkdsk /fand press Enter. -
If the system reports that it cannot run the check because the disk is in use, type
Yand press Enter to schedule the check for the next system restart.
-
If you had to schedule the check, restart your computer for the check to be performed.
